§1101. Contracts in restraint of trade
Every contract, combination in the form of trusts or otherwise, or conspiracy, in restraint of trade or commerce in this State is declared to be illegal. Whoever makes any such contract or engages in any such combination or conspiracy is guilty of a Class C crime. [2003, c. 46, §1 (AMD).]
SECTION HISTORY
1973, c. 489, §1 (AMD). 1977, c. 175, §1 (AMD). 2003, c. 46, §1 (AMD).
